Lip Spasms
I was doing a practice crit the other day, a very hard one at that (I'm a 4 and there were 1's and 2's up front driving the peloton). I was fatigued due to a 2-hour warm up with the team. We did the long warmup since it was, after all, just a training crit. I had also ridden a decent 50 mi tempo ride the day before. No doubt, I was fatigued.
At any rate, in the latter half of the race my upper lip was spasming. It hasn't happened since. What causes spasms in unrelated parts of the body?
